ASPIRE Separates from BoosterASPIRE Separates from Booster
October 26, 2018
In this image, the second stage of the Black Brant IX sounding rocket separates from the ASPIRE payload. The third and final flight test of the ASPIRE payload was launched from NASA's Wallops Flight Facility on Sept. 7, 2018.

ASPIRE ParachuteASPIRE Parachute
October 26, 2018
This high-definition image was taken on Sept. 7, 2018, during the third and final test flight of the ASPIRE payload. It was the fastest inflation of this size parachute in history and created a peak load of almost 70,000 pounds of force.
